Why is moissanite usually more affordable than a diamond?

Moissanite costs less largely because it’s a different gemstone with a very different supply chain. Natural diamonds are rare and priced around scarcity, while lab-grown diamonds still carry diamond grading and market positioning. Moissanite offers a bright, durable, premium-looking alternative at a lower cost, which is why many couples use it to maximize size or spend more on the ring setting, wedding plans, or other priorities.
